Deborah Schmall is widely recognized as one of the leading environmental law practitioners in California. She recently served as the Co-Chair of the Global Environment and Energy Practice at Paul Hastings. She is ranked Band One in Chambers for California Environmental Law.
Starting with her career at the U.S. Justice Department’s Environmental Enforcement Section, where she prosecuted civil and criminal enforcement matters under a range of federal environmental laws, Deborah has practiced environmental law for decades. Her specialty areas include:
- Government enforcement actions and citizen suits.
- Complex, multi-party remediation driven by federal or state agencies or private parties and related dispute resolution proceedings.
- Hazardous materials or waste regulatory compliance and permitting.
- Water quality regulatory compliance and permitting.
- Facility closure regulatory compliance and permitting.
In addition, clients turn to Deborah for her strategic counsel at high-profile Brownfield developments, including Mission Bay in San Francisco, a proposed new MLB stadium in Oakland, and a pending mixed-use development over a regulated landfill in Santa Clara. Deborah also has led environmental negotiations in connection with large M&A transactions for petroleum and pharmaceutical companies, mid-market divestitures and acquisitions, and more than 100 real property transactions.
Deborah’s practice spans a range of industries: pharmaceutical, technology, telecommunications, natural resources, and residential and commercial development. Her representative clients include AT&T, BHP Petroleum, Cargill, Genentech Inc., Prologis, the Oakland Athletics, and Western Digital Corporation. In 2021, Chambers noted her clients described her as “absolutely phenomenal” and that her “retention of detail is precise and unmatched. Her dedication is unwavering, and her advice is strategic and thoughtful."
Over her career, Deborah has been active in environmental policy matters. She was one of the founding members of the California State Bar’s Environmental Law Section (now a part of the California Lawyers Association) and served on its first Executive Committee. She has also served as an invited member of a private-government collaborative group focusing on Brownfield regulatory reform, and is on the board of directors of the Center for Creative Land Recycling, a national non-profit organization promoting progressive governmental policies and funding for Brownfield developments.
